Steps to Obtain a Finnish Driver's License

  1. Comprehending the Requirements

    • Candidates need to prove their identity.
    • Medical exams might be required for particular lorry classes.
  2. Completing Driver Education

    • A theory test covering road rules and driving behavior.
    • Practical driving lessons with a certified trainer.
  3. Taking the Driving Tests

    • Passing the theory test.
    • Successfully finishing a practical driving exam.
  4. Application Submission

    • After passing tests, submit an application through the regional cops or driving license authority.
  5. Getting the License

    • If effective, you'll receive your official chauffeur's license.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)


Q1: Is it possible to convert a foreign license into a Finnish motorist's license?

A: Yes, Finland enables the conversion of particular foreign driver's licenses into a Finnish license, supplied specific requirements are met, consisting of legitimate residency and compliance with regional traffic policies.

Q2: Can I drive in Finland with a worldwide driving permit (IDP)?

A: Yes, an IDP stands in Finland for approximately one year for tourists and temporary locals, provided it's accompanied by a legitimate driver's license from your home country.

Q3: How long does it require to obtain a Finnish driver's license?

A: The timeframe differs depending upon the person's preparation and schedule. Normally, it may take a number of weeks to a couple of months to finish the essential requirements and tests.

Q4: What occurs if I'm caught driving without a legitimate license in Finland?

A: Being captured driving without a valid license may lead to fines, potential criminal charges, and confiscation of the vehicle. It is important to stick to traffic laws and licensing requirements.
